Hugo部署记录
部署准备
根据官网提示快速入门 |雨 果 (gohugo.io) 选定windows终端
如果您是 Windows 用户:
不要使用命令提示符
不要使用 Windows PowerShell
从 PowerShell 或 Linux 终端(如 WSL 或 Git Bash)运行这些命令
PowerShell 和 Windows PowerShell 是不同的应用程序。
本机装好git
开始部署hugo文档有三种部署方式 ,选用Package managers 部署比较简单
Package managers 中有 Chocolatey、Scoop、Winget 三种命令,前两个需要格外安装,第三种自带,选用第三种,运行
1winget install Hugo.Hugo.Extended
安装的是hugo的扩展版(Extended),方便以后安装模板。
创建站点运行这些命令以创建具有 Ananke 主题的 Hugo 站点。
123456hugo new site quickstart ## quickstart为创建的站点文件夹,可随意改名称cd quickstart ...
分享 20 + 个在线工具网站
在线工具网站
RegExr: https://regexr.com/
正则表达式在线测试工具。
在线编译工具:https://ide.judge0.com/
可以在线执行编程语言与 SQL 语句
rextester:https://rextester.com/
在线执行 PHP、Python、C、Java 等各种语言代码。
Ideone:https://ideone.com/
在线执行 PHP、Python、C、Java 等各种语言代码。
GDB online Debugger:https://www.onlinegdb.com/
在线执行 PHP、Python、C、Java 等各种语言代码。
JSFiddle:https://jsfiddle.net/
前端代码在线执行工具。
CodePen:https://codepen.io/
前端代码在线执行工具。
Redis 在线测试:https://try.redis.io/
Redis 命令在线测试工具
Paiza:https://paiza.io
在线编译工具,包含 Python、Java、MySQL 等。
Learn ...
Github推送
步骤如下:
拉取远程仓库的更改:1git pull origin main
这个命令会从远程仓库 origin 的 main 分支拉取最新的提交,并尝试合并到你的本地 main 分支。
解决冲突 (如果存在):如果 git pull 命令提示有冲突,你需要手动解决这些冲突。Git 会在冲突的文件中标记出冲突的部分,你需要编辑这些文件,选择保留哪些更改,然后将文件标记为已解决。
提交合并后的更改:12git add .git commit -m "Merge remote changes"
将解决冲突后的文件添加到暂存区,并提交合并后的更改。
推送你的本地更改:1git push origin main
现在,你的本地 main 分支和远程仓库的 main 分支同步了,你可以成功推送你的本地更改。
(Armbian)空间不足解决办法-docker目录转移
设置u盘自动挂载
1.插入u盘
123# 查看u盘路径/大小/typefdisk -l# 如/dev/sda4
格式化u盘为exc4,保持默认,等待完成
12# 举例mkfs.ext4 /dev/sda4
3.创建挂载目录
12# 举例mkdir /mnt/upan
查看u盘UUID
12# 举例blkid /dev/sda4
修改配置文件,在/etc/fstab后追加
12# 例子,uuid和路径改成自己的UUID=a63dfbda-29c8-478f-a88e-55796514c961 /mnt/upan/ ext4 defaults 0 0
挂载目录修改权限
1chmod -R 777 /mnt/upan/
重启
1reboot -n
检查
挂载目录下存在lost+found目录即为成功
Docker 修改默认存储路径
在刚刚的挂载目录下创建docker目录
1mkdir /mnt/upan/docker
记录原储存路径
12docker info|grep "Docker Root ...
更改WordPress网站URL四种方法
WordPress地址和站点地址是非常重要的字段,因为它们是引用网站到互联网上的地址,以及网站文件的位置。本文将分享四种不同的方法,来轻松更改WordPress网站URL。首先我们来了解下为什么要更改WordPress网站URL?
很多情况下需要更改WordPress URL的原因。例如:
1、将WordPress从本地服务器移动到正式站点时,需要更新站点URL 。
2、如果已将WordPress网站移至新域名,则需要更改网站URL以反映所做的更改。
3、如果要将WordPress移至其他目录,例如从WordPress url中删除/ wordpress /。
4、当将WordPress从HTTP转移到HTTPS时,需要更改它。
除此之外,如果您在WordPress中看到太多重定向错误或在对另一个WordPress错误进行故障排除时,可能需要更改WordPress地址设置。
WordPress地址与站点地址
更改WordPress网站URL时,需要更新两个单独的设置:WordPress地址和站点地址。对于很多初学者可能会造成混淆,因为他们不知道这两者之间的区别。
W ...
新搭建Debian配置
切换镜像源etc/apt/
debian | 镜像站使用帮助 | 清华大学开源软件镜像站 | Tsinghua Open Source Mirror
安装apt curl[Debian(Linux)系统安装并使用sudo命令 - SpringCore - 博客园 (cnblogs.com)](https://www.cnblogs.com/fanqisoft/p/17559561.html#:~:text=Debian(Linux)系统安装并使用sudo命令 1.查看是否安装 dpkg -l|grep sudo 2.安装 1.切换到root用户,su - root 2.安装sudo apt-get install sudo)
Debian如何安装curl? - Cobcmw - 博客园 (cnblogs.com)
设置允许root用户登录SSH_root ssh 登录 执行命令-CSDN博客
docker权限设置:让非root用户可以操作docker–》附带:linux新增用户添加root权限_linux docker 添加用户权限-CSDN博客
无畏契约代充教程
1a17762416c8440d80bd7914d00ad07a23b7bf1885975bdb4f8c6bae4401a6b3e4b856f0d5f404945a37e68ecb2597017892fccc0080ba10fe0af38ab5b9ca0744ebe5a83363a4d0cf93092350fbee26e48c0a57db8438428e21c6ec92e3d1f58ea9944aeb001df4a237cc4be28e659c8189cffed5996448422a8a227d4b86149eb21e512af10814846342cad1db433189881182e44e798b933e3687dd8d215c672a448161bfe12d5ee893165c80720b3d7c03cf09c8294acba639d1216c490abf190388a4c3524c28703e95a06181a625c1a9d4060f276cf24cf7bcb284803435207c919fa2597aea00ba6f34b2c87fa6d7804662cae88dd ...
利用 API 自己搭建一个 ChatGPT 网站
搭建背景:用过 ChatGPT 的朋友都知道,官方网站非常喜欢宕机。既然如此,那我们就自己搭建一个私信 ChatGPT 服务器吧,直接调用 API 的话,就不担心它会崩溃了。
搭建的方法有很多,以下是参考开源工程项目的搭建方式
一、创建 API key可以搜索 Open AI 官网,登录到个人 Open AI 账户主页获取你的 API 密钥。
点击 “Create new Secret key” 按钮创建新的密钥,此时会生成新的密钥,然后点击复制按钮先保存一下密钥,后面需要用到(密钥只会显示一次,因此要在第一时间保存好,忘了保存可以再生成一个)。
二、注册并登录 GitHub没有 GitHub 的需要先注册登录,在这就不细说了。
登录 GitHub 之后搜索 “chatgpt-demo”,就可以找到一个镜像 ChatGPT 项目。
三、打开项目后往下翻,找到 “Deploy” 按钮,进入 Vercel 页面。四、GitHub 登录 Vercel进入 Vercel 页面之后选择 GitHub 登录,我这因为之前登陆过,默认登录上了。
接下来填入一个名称,然后点击 “Creat” 按钮
五 ...
CNAME解析至cf:分流解析cloudflare处理国外请求
域名接入cloudflare此处不再赘述如何创建cloudflare账号,在cloudflare官网创建好账号后
登录 => 主页 => 添加网站
输入你的域名
选择Free计划
cloudflare会扫描已有DNS记录,将已有的DNS记录添加进去,这一步很重要,防止出现服务中断,如果这一步没做好,可能会有部分站点后面没有解析导致出现网站不可访问的现象,将所有已经有的解析记录都在这一步加好。
获取到cloudflare到NS服务器地址
登录你的域名厂商解析修改域名的DNS服务器,此处以腾讯云举例打开 域名控制台 点击修改DNS服务器地址
添加上刚刚在cloudflare获取到的DNS服务器地址,两个都加上,此时只是暂时改,为了通过✅cloudflare的监测,通过以后就可以改回来了。
等待⌛️10分钟左右,cloudflare会发送一封邮件📧 说明DNS服务器修改成功,改成功以后就可以正式开始接入了,在左侧的DNS->记录可以找到你的所有记录,在这里可以把你的解析记录都加好,解析到你的服务器上,并且打开代理状态的小云朵☁️,亮起则代表,clo ...
MarkDown编辑器Typora
软件介绍Typora中文版是一款Markdown编辑器及阅读器的文本编辑器.Typora破解版风格极简/多种主题/支持macOS,Windows及 Linux,实时预览/图片与文字/代码块/数学公式/图表 目录大纲/文件管理/导入与导出等..
软件截图
版本特点- 免激活中文绿色版,劫持破解激活版,免安装绿化版
- 删除多国语言,提供快速关联文件类型及清理批处理
下载地址蓝奏网盘